Oh, Josh Norman, NFL'er and Lee graduate, has already started a petition through Facebook. I'm sure it will be changed. What is interesting to me is that these folks go along with the masses without even researching the person. Lee was actually very much against slavery. Reminds me of the people that were up in arms that Hereford High School's team name is the White Faces. For those that do not know, White Faces were in reference to Hereford cattle that are prevalent in that area.
